Output 25dd54ea1fc84acc607103a9b99e6418b9a9a7da843e1aa8738593c2f0a92d21:7

value
12582801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43aa885c25abc74e6a6a59979207e198e88e99be OP_EQUAL
address
ME4wo6iwqCmk5GKmnm5nXewWDvqYFEacDa
transaction
25dd54ea1fc84acc607103a9b99e6418b9a9a7da843e1aa8738593c2f0a92d21
spent
true